Each year, Washington state schools are selected by the Office of Superintendent of Public Instruction (OSPI) for the National and State ESEA Distinguished Schools Awards. Using school multiple data points, OSPI selects federally funded schools for their outstanding academic achievements of their students. Up to two schools with the highest student performance and academic growth are selected for the national award. Two or more schools are selected for the state award. The schools chosen for national recognition will be honored at the National ESEA Conference.
These schools demonstrate a wide array of strengths, including team approaches to teaching and learning, focused professional development opportunities for staff, individualized programs for student success, and strong partnerships between the school, parents, and the community.
